once again: the files outputted by nerodigital are simply 100% mpeg-4 spec compliant mpeg-4 avc streams in the mpeg-4 container .mp4
you can play it with any player that supports
1) the .mp4 container
2) decoding avc streams

if you would have read my faq and used search you would know that this is already possible with the
- nero dshow filters in any dshow player
- moonlight dshow filters in any dshow player
- enviviotv dshow filters in any dshow player
- videolan
- mplayer
